SSL mode set to Full (Strict) with Cloudflare origin certificate installed at the server for end-to-end encryption. Certificate management automated through Cloudflare so renewals never expire unexpectedly.
CDN caching rules, static asset cache TTL, image optimisation, minification, and HTTP/3 configured. Cloudflare's performance features typically improve Core Web Vitals scores measurably for sites with international visitors.
No. You only need to point your domain's nameservers to Cloudflare. Your domain registration stays with your current registrar. The DNS migration is handled as part of setup with zero downtime, every record is verified in Cloudflare before the nameserver cutover is made.
The free plan provides DDoS protection and basic WAF access. The Pro plan at $20/month adds WAF custom rules, which is the minimum for meaningful application-layer protection. Business plan adds advanced bot management and rate limiting features. For most small and mid-sized businesses, the Pro plan with custom WAF rules configured by an expert provides significantly better protection than the Business plan with default settings.
DNS migration and basic security configuration typically complete within one business day. Full WAF rule writing, bot protection, and rate limiting configuration adds 2 to 4 days depending on application complexity. The complete setup including testing is typically delivered within one week.
Yes. Cloudflare's global CDN caches static assets at edge locations close to your users, reducing time to first byte significantly for international visitors. Image optimisation, minification, and HTTP/3 support further improve performance. Many clients see measurable Core Web Vitals improvements after Cloudflare setup simply from the CDN and performance features, independent of the security benefits.

Cloudflare is most useful when DNS, proxying, SSL/TLS, caching and security controls are configured together. A setup should also account for the origin server and the application so a security change does not create a performance or compatibility problem.
The review can include DNS records, proxy status, SSL/TLS mode, cache behavior, WAF configuration, DDoS controls, bot protection, rate limiting, origin exposure and application-specific exceptions.
